Andalusia Condo, located at 6200 W Flagler St, Miami, FL, is a charming 4-story residential building constructed in 1973. The structure offers a mix of well-designed 1 and 2-bedroom units, tailored for comfortable living. Built with quality materials typical of its era, the building showcases a simple yet robust architectural design that has stood the test of time. Residents of Andalusia Condo enjoy a variety of on-site amenities designed to enhance their lifestyle. Among these are a community pool ideal for relaxation and leisure, a secure parking area, and laundry facilities that add convenience to everyday living. While the building is not situated on the waterfront, its location provides easy access to nearby parks and recreational areas. Surrounding Andalusia Condo, the vibrant district offers a rich array of cultural experiences, dining options, and shopping centers. The neighborhood is well-served by public transportation, allowing for easy commuting to other parts of Miami. The building falls under the 33144 zip code, which is known for its diverse community and proximity to key urban attractions. Overall, Andalusia Condo presents a harmonious blend of functional living and community engagement, making it a notable fixture in the Miami residential scene.
